Predicting Safety Hazards Among Construction Workers and Equipment Using Computer Vision and Deep Learning Techniques

TL;DR: A methodology to monitor and analyse the interaction between workers and equipment by detecting their locations and trajectories and identifying the danger zones using computer vision and deep learning techniques is proposed.

Detection of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) Compliance on Construction Site Using Computer Vision Based Deep Learning Techniques

TL;DR: A framework to sense in real-time, the safety compliance of construction workers with respect to PPE is developed, intended to be integrated into the safety workflow of an organization, and provides evidence on the feasibility and utility of computer vision-based techniques in automating the safety-related compliance processes at construction sites.

Governance issues in BOT based PPP infrastructure projects in India

TL;DR: In this article, the authors identify the combinations of economic, normative, reputational and cognitive mechanisms that can prevent post-award governance challenges on build-operate-transfer (BOT) projects in India.
